RXP GTN 650 shows BLACK screen in X-Plane

Featured Replies

The Garmin GTN Trainer is installed properly.

Here's what I get in the rxp logs after enabling the debug options.

Can anyone help please?

20/02/05 19:22:00.976 07908 INFO ] GTN 650.1 - TRAINER 6620
20/02/05 19:22:01.005 07908 INFO ] C:\Program Files (x86)\Garmin\Trainers\Packages\GTN\Bin
20/02/05 19:22:01.027 07908 INFO ] C:\Program Files (x86)\Garmin\Trainers\Packages\GTN\data
20/02/05 19:22:01.061 07908 INFO ] C:\ProgramData\Garmin\Trainers\Databases
20/02/05 19:22:01.092 07908 INFO ] C:\ProgramData\Garmin\Trainers\GTN\nonvol
20/02/05 19:22:01.133 07908 WARN ] GTN 650.1 process is running as-admin
20/02/05 19:22:02.265 07908 INFO ] using: %LOCAL_APPDATA%\CrashRpt\UnsentCrashReports\GTN Trainer_6.62.0.0RXP
20/02/05 19:22:03.441 07908 ERROR] GL failed false false
20/02/05 19:22:03.469 07908 ERROR] GL failed(false,b3011d05,00000000,00000000)
20/02/05 19:22:03.516 07908 ERROR] GL missing pixel_buffer_object
20/02/05 19:22:03.585 07908 ERROR] GL missing framebuffer_object
20/02/05 19:22:03.619 07908 ERROR] GL missing framebuffer_blit
20/02/05 19:22:03.658 07908 WARN ] FAIL: 00 ..\..\lib\acl\tsk\uncertified\tsk_sim_win_crash_rpt.cpp(141) Line #141 Windows crash handler called.

 

2 hours ago, rhanna said:

20/02/05 19:22:03.441 07908 ERROR] GL failed false false

There is a problem with your OpenGL stack somehow. Please review the RXP GTN User's Manual troubleshooting section for this.

  • Author

Thanks.

The only troubleshooting tip in the Manual that might be related to this issue that I found is the one to "Force App to Use NVIDIA Graphics Card".

I have tried that but to no avail.

What tip/hints are you pointing me to?

Are you using any kind of software like 'ReShade' or similar post-processing tool?

They 'hack' between the application and the driver and may cause failures too.
